1966 Mazda Familia vs. 1969 Subaru FF-1
To start off, 1969 Subaru FF-1 is newer by 3 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1966 Mazda Familia.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1966 Mazda Familia would be higher. At 1,088 cc (4 cylinders), 1969 Subaru FF-1 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1966 Mazda Familia (57 HP @ 6500 RPM) has 5 more horse power than 1969 Subaru FF-1. (52 HP @ 6000 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 1966 Mazda Familia should accelerate faster than 1969 Subaru FF-1.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1966 Mazda Familia weights approximately 95 kg more than 1969 Subaru FF-1.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Let's talk about torque, 1969 Subaru FF-1 (85 Nm @ 3200 RPM) has 4 more torque (in Nm) than 1966 Mazda Familia. (81 Nm @ 4600 RPM). This means 1969 Subaru FF-1 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1966 Mazda Familia.
